[#1] EC060/75MHz - tym razem soft :((
Ja Was kocham i nie mogę bez Was, bo zawsze pomagacie. Mam nadzieję, że jeszcze nie macie dosyć mnie i mojego Apollo. ;)

No bo jest tak: ze stroną sprzętową się uporałem, pozostała nie mniej pogięta przeprawa z softem. Otóż moje Apollo (pierwotnie 040) ma chyba w epromie bibliotekę 68040.library. Wnoszę po tym, że moja Amiga bez żadnej biblioteki procesora w katalogu Libs od razu po starcie widzi procesor jako 040/40. Tzn. widzą go tak wszystkie programy, nawet SysSpeed, który przecież "kuma 060". Wrzucenie do katalogu Libs Apollowskiej wersji biblioteki 68060.library powoduje, że Amiga nie ładuje systemu do końca, tylko wiesza się zaraz po starcie. Pomaga wyłączenie SetPatcha, ale nie zmienia to faktu, że procesor nadal widziany jest jako 040/40. Bez zainstalowanych w Libsach bibliotek procesora, SetPatch w niczym nie przeszkadza i amiga odpala się normalnie.

W tak pogiętej konfiguracji oczywiście mało co działa. Np. ShapeShifter resetuje Amigę w momencie otwierania ekranu (2 kolory, Amiga Bitplanes, bez MMU refresh), NemacIV wywala guru 0003D, itp. Poprawnie chodzi klasyczny soft, komaptybilny z 68000 i dema. Te ostatnie wyraźnie wolniej, niż na CyberStormie 060/50, chociaż na logikę powinny tak samo, skoro nie korzystają z FPU i MMU.

I tutaj zapytanie: czy da się jakoś, nie wymieniając MACHów i epromu, zmusić kartę, aby korzystała z biblioteki procesora z Libs, a nie z Epromu? Czy nie wymieniając MACHów (nie mam pojęcia skąd je zdobyć, Elbox nie ma) wogóle da się zmusić kartę do w miarę poprawnej pracy z EC060, czy może lepiej przelutować 040 z powrotem i dać sobie spokój?

Pozdrawiam, padamdonóżek.
[#2]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#1

Nie chodzi o to, że 68040.library jest w romie (bo jej tam nie ma) a o to, że system rozpoznaje tylko do procesora 68040 (bo 060 chyba jeszcze nie było gdy powstawał AOS3.1)
W ten sposób 68060 też jest wykrywany przez system jako 68040 i automatycznie (poprzez SetPatch) jest ładowana 68040.library (dlatego w programach masz podawane 68040). Nic nie da dogranie 68060.library, bo system ją i tak oleje.
Rozwiązaniem tego był komplet bibliotek dla kart phase5.
Tam 68040.library (domyślnie ładowana przez system gdy wykrył 040/060) była maleńkim plikiem (4KB) sprawdzającym czy to nie jest 060 i jeżeli tak było to ładowała 68060.library, a jeżeli był to 040 to 68040new.library

Komplet libsów do kart phase5 powinien pomóc.
Masz je np. tu.
Przegraj tylko same biblioteki pamiętając aby zmienić nazwę 68040.library na 68040new.library a 68040dummy.library na 68040.library (to jest właśnie ten mały pliczek sprawdzający czy procesor to 040 czy 060).



Ostatnia modyfikacja: 27.06.06 11:04
[#3] Re: EC060/75MHz - tym razem soft :((

@amigafan, post #2

Znalazłem taki komplet dedykowany Apollo na http://www.l8r.net/install/accel.html. Tam jest właśnie mały plik 68040.library i duży 68060.libary i to właśnie w po zainstalowaniu tego zestawu mam wiechę przy uruchamianiu SetPatcha. Może SetPatch trzeba inny?
[#4]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#3

Na stronie http://www.canit.se/~glenn/apollo.html jest opisany dokładnie Twój problem:

P: My Amiga works if I boot without setpatch, but gives a guru directly if I try to start it ?

S: Have you really installed the librarys supplied with the card ? you HAVE to use the 68040.library,68o4o.library and 68060.library from ACT, do NOT use commodores original 68040.library

Więc problem leży zapewne po stronie niewłaściwych (lub źle zainstalowanych) bibliotek.



Ostatnia modyfikacja: 27.06.06 11:20
[#5] Re: EC060/75MHz - tym razem soft :((

@amigafan, post #4

Wydaje mi się, że te które znalazłem wyglądają wiarygodnie.

Ale może ktoś zna jakieś pewniejsze źródło, z którego można je pobrać?
[#6]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#5

No ale dlaczego mimo wszystko, nie wyprobujesz tych z Fazy5? I co z tego ze powstaly dla Blizzarda? Przeciez wyprobowac nie zaszkodzi :)
[#7] Re: EC060/75MHz - tym razem soft :((

@amigafan, post #2

Ja się dziwię, że ta Amiga wogóle startuje. CyberstormMKII w A4000 nie był w stanie ruszyć, jeśli przed jego instalacją nie zainstalowało się poprawnie biblioteki 060.
[#8]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#7

Co do tej 68040.library, to najprościej sprawdzić komendą version 68040.library, oczywiście, po wcześniejszym wykasowaniu lub zmianie nazwy tej na dysku. Gdy komenda jest w Epromie, to dostaniesz jej wersję.
[#9] Re: EC060/75MHz - tym razem soft :((

@wali7, post #8

A da się ją podmienić, gdyby okazało się, że jest w EPROMie?
[#10]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#7

CyberstormMKII w A4000 nie był w stanie ruszyć

Był w stanie bez komendy SetPatch ;)

[#11]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#9

Pewnie da się to zrobić programowo - były takie moduły do blizkicka co wywalały PPC.library chociażby. Może RemApollo potrafi zrobić podobną rzecz z 68040.library?
[#12]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#5

Dzis wysle Ci biblioteki, ktore uzywalem z moim Apollo1260:))))..mam obrazy kilku dyskietek jak pamietam:) Sorki, ze dopiero teraz, ale problem z netem mialem...
PS.Masz w koncu LC, czy EC?



Ostatnia modyfikacja: 27.06.06 14:31
[#13]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#1

Spójrz tu.

Koleś przetaktował Apollo1240 na 1260/78MHz (użył pełnej wersji 060/50MHz) jak wynika z obrazków wymieniał ROM karty.

Namiary na niego są tu. Proponuję się skontaktować, gdyż pewnie będzie najbardziej kompententną osobą w tym temacie.



Ostatnia modyfikacja: 27.06.06 14:36
[#14]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#9

no 100% nie masz jej w romie,zainstaluj pakiet bibliotek chocby i z phase5 i sprawdz,btw.
pamietaj jeszcze ze dobrze jest miec zainstalowany mcpramlibpatch na takie rozne smieszne sytuacje :)

[#15]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#1

No więc sprawdziłem. W EPROMie nie ma biblioteki procesora. Zainstalowanie biblioteki 060 dedykowanej Apollo, jak również tej od Cyberstorma kończy się zawsze tak samo: ramlib failed zaraz po starcie systemu. Zakładam, że potrzebna jest specjalna wersja biblioteki 060 pod porcesor LC. Musiało coś takiego powstać, bo istnieje wersja Apollo z takim procesorem montowanym fabrycznie. Pytanie:

Gdzie tego szukać?
Zwykłe biblioteki pod Apollo trudno znaleść...

HELP! :(
[#16]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#15

LC? Przecież wczesniej pisałeś że EC

[#17] Re: EC060/75MHz - tym razem soft :((

@Malin, post #16

LC. Ale wszystko jedno - spróbuję wszystkiego.
[#18]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#17

No nie tak "wszystko jedno" .Z tego co pamiętam to LC to brak (wyłączony) FPU,a EC to brak MMU.
[#19] Re: EC060/75MHz - tym razem soft :((

@waldiamiga, post #18

według BBAH:
68LC060 - no FPU (http://www.amiga-hardware.com/showhardware.cgi?HARDID=1484)
68EC060 - no FPU, no MMU (http://www.amiga-hardware.com/showhardware.cgi?HARDID=1483)
[#20] Re: EC060/75MHz - tym razem soft :((

@wali7, post #19

Wiem czym one się różnią. Mój problem polega na czym innym: gdzie znaleść biblioteki 060 pracujące z okrojonym procesorem. Jakiekolwiek, a nóź coś zadziała.
[#21]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#20

Tak czytam se i sie zastanawiam ze stan wiedzy o ami jest totalnie niski.Jesli chodzi o bibliotekie 60.library to musi byc do Apollo dedykowana gdyz w blizardzie jest inaczej widziana pamiec i beda jajca.Jesli do karty apollo wstawiles 60 procka a byla 40 to musisz wymienic eproma a jesli procek ma wiecej taktowania jak 66MHz to musisz wymienic procki mach poniewaz procki 68xxx0 maja zbudowana szyne danch dosc ciekawie jest to w zasadzie czestotliwosc zegara dzielona przez 4 lub 2 jesli by procek mial 75 mhz to wtedy zegar mozesz miec 37.5 lub 18.75 i to do niczego nie pasuje .Mysle ze problem polega na tym ze procki mach uzyte w apollo maja marna mozliwosc podniesienia taktowania i dlatego ta karta sie tak zwiesza .I moja rada stabilizator zasilania dla procka 75 mhz musi miec wieksza wydajnosc pradowa o jakies 20% jesli zbudowales sobie zasilacz w oparciu o orginalna konstrukcje z apollo 1260/66 to moze byc za malo pradu i dlatego masz te zwisy.Ten stabilizatorek byl do procka taktowanego za slaby i dziala na granicy mozliwosci.
[#22]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#20

Podeslalem Ci wczoraj na maila te libsy;)

[#23] Re: EC060/75MHz - tym razem soft :((

@Dziadziomiecio, post #21

Karta się NIE zawiesza. Aktualny problem polega na niemożności wgrania biblioteki 68060.library (każda wersja). Bez żadnej bibilioteki karta pracuje stabilnie, tylko wykazuje obniżoną wydajność (poziom ~040/40) i niekompatybilność z częścią softu (np. ShapeShifter, NemacIV).

P.S Jakie są konsekwencje pozostania przy starym EPROMie (tym od 040)?
[#24] Re: EC060/75MHz - tym razem soft :((

@MrT, post #22

Wiem, dzięki, w domu obadam.

:)
[#25]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#23

tylko musisz pamietac ze jak masz wgrane libsy to karta dopiero zaczyna dzialac z wlasciwa dla siebie predkoscia i wtedy ma wlasciwy pobur mocy jesli chodzi o libsy to poszukaj tworce Remapollo on pisal patch do bibliteki to moze i bedzie wiedzial wiecej cz musisz miec specjalnie z preparowana biblioteke czy nie
[#26] Re: EC060/75MHz - tym razem soft :((

@Dziadziomiecio, post #25

Hej,
Podpinam sie do tematu. Wsadzilem do apollo 040 ec060@75. machy sa w wersji z koncowka 31, sprawne, testowane na innej karcie. Stabilizator napiecia jak sadze dobrze wykonalem (dziekuje dziadziomieco:),ale karta nie wstaje. Niby ok,procek sie grzeje, reset z klawy dziala,ale sie nie budzi...jakies sugestie? Szczegolnie dziadziomiecio i Dacław-obeznani w temacie.

Chce zaznaczyc, ze juz wymienailem procki i sprzet porem wstawal, wiec raczej zrobilem to tym razem takze poprawnie.

POZDRAWIAM!

[#27] Re: EC060/75MHz - tym razem soft :((

@Dziadziomiecio, post #21

Pytanie pierwsze gdzie są epromy na karcie apollo??

Jest mit mówiący o tym ,że trzeba zmieniać układy mach przy zmianie procesora z 040 na 060 jednak jest to mit.



Benedykt

[#28] Re: EC060/75MHz - tym razem soft :((

@MrT, post #26

Zakładam, że zworki masz ustawione poprawnie...

Z jaką częstotliwością taktujesz tę kartę? Jeśli chcesz więcej, niż 50MHz, musisz przelutować opornik SMD oznaczony CLKEN z pozycji GDN na CLK.

Zanim to zrobisz, wsadź kwarca 50MHz. Jeśli wszystko jest OK, karta powinna ruszyć.
[#29] Re: EC060/75MHz - tym razem soft :((

@Daclaw, post #28

Mam kwarca 50mhz, cisza..hmm..moglbys prosze dokladnie opisac jak zmieniles napiecie?Ja wsadzilem stabilizator 3,3v,na in 5v, na out 3,3, gnd do gnd...

[#30] Re: EC060/75MHz - tym razem soft :((

@MrT, post #29

Trzeba dać jeszcze jakieś kondensatory. Kurcze, nie pamiętam jakie, bo nie robiłem zdjęć a Amigi za skarby świata nie chcę teraz rozkręcać. Miałem katalog elektroniki (chyba Elfy), gdzie przy opisie stabilizatora był schemacik aplikacji. W każdym razie sam działałem na czuja.
Na stronie www.PPA.pl, podobnie jak na wielu innych stronach internetowych, wykorzystywane są tzw. cookies (ciasteczka). Służą ona m.in. do tego, aby zalogować się na swoje konto, czy brać udział w ankietach. Ze względu na nowe regulacje prawne jesteśmy zobowiązani do poinformowania Cię o tym w wyraźniejszy niż dotychczas sposób. Dalsze korzystanie z naszej strony bez zmiany ustawień przeglądarki internetowej będzie oznaczać, że zgadzasz się na ich wykorzystywanie.
OK, rozumiem